Economy & Jobs

Fair Lawn residents earn a median household income of $147,952 , which is 97% above the national average of $75,149. Per capita income is $60,114. The unemployment rate stands at 3.2% (11% below the U.S. rate of 3.6%). 3.9% of residents live below the poverty line. The area is home to 36,016 business establishments, including 2,730 restaurants.

Housing & Cost of Living

The median home value in Fair Lawn is $532,700 , 89% above the national median of $281,900. Zillow estimates the typical home at $697,458. Median rent is $1,908/month, with 36.3% of renters spending more than 30% of income on housing. The cost of living index is 108.8 (100 = national average). The median home was built in 1953.

Safety & Crime

Fair Lawn reports 21 violent crimes per 100,000 residents , which is 94% below the national average of 380/100K. Property crime is 714/100K. The murder rate is 0.0/100K.

Education

64.2% of adults in Fair Lawn hold a bachelor's degree or higher (91% above the national average). 96.8% have completed high school. Local schools score 7.3/10 in standardized testing.

Climate & Weather

Fair Lawn has an average annual temperature of 55°F (13°C). Winters average 33°F in January while summers reach 78°F in July. The area gets 275 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 46.3 inches.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 39.
